Exclusive for SurgeOS 2! Xiaomi mobile phones/tablets start the no-network positioning test

Xiaomi Community has launched invitations for Xiaomi mobile phones/tablets to test without network positioning, recruiting users to provide test feedback.
This function allows the Pengpai OS 2 device to be located even when there is no network, making it easy to retrieve the device if it is lost or left behind.
This test is to confirm the accuracy and timeliness of mobile phone/tablet positioning in offline state, and requires at least two mobile phones or tablets upgraded to Xiaomi Pengpai OS 2.
Judging from the official information, this offline positioning function should use Bluetooth to connect to surrounding devices to report the location, which is similar to the current positioning mode of Apple and Huawei.
When the device is lost and has no network connection, it will automatically connect and communicate with surrounding Xiaomi devices and report its own location.

The test method is as follows:
① Enable the function: If your registration is approved, please go to “Settings-Account-Find Device-Location Settings” and turn on “No Network Positioning”.
② Simulate loss scenario:
Simulate lost device A: Turn off the network (WiFi/mobile data), keep Bluetooth on, and keep the device with you (for example: in your pocket or bag) for more than 30 minutes.
Simulate the search for device B: Turn off Bluetooth and view the offline location on the “Find Device” map page (a gray circle and an update time of ≤30 minutes is considered successful).
Recommended testing locations: shopping malls, stations and other high traffic areas.
